Quiner Gulch
Quiner Gulch is a valley in Park, Colorado and has an elevation of 7,641 feet. Quiner Gulch is situated nearby to the hamlet Insmont, as well as near Estabrook.Places of Interest

Mount Bailey
Peak
Mount Bailey is a mountain summit in the Front Range of the Rocky Mountains of North America. The 9,089-foot peak is located 1.0 mile northeast of the community of Bailey in Park County, Colorado, United States. Mount Bailey is situated 1½ miles north of Quiner Gulch.
Coney Island Hot Dog Stand
Fast food restaurant

Coney Island Colorado in Bailey, Colorado, is a 1950s diner shaped like a giant hot dog, with toppings. The building has been called "the best example of roadside architecture in the state". Coney Island Hot Dog Stand is situated 2½ miles northwest of Quiner Gulch.

Shawnee
Village

Shawnee is an unincorporated community and post office in northern Park County, Colorado, United States, that is a historic district listed on the National Register of Historic Places. Shawnee is situated 6 miles west of Quiner Gulch.
Pine Junction
Village

Pine Junction is a small unincorporated community in central Colorado in the United States. Pine Junction is the first intersection with a traffic light on U.S. Highway 285 in the foothills. Pine Junction is situated 6 miles northeast of Quiner Gulch.
